Sabca has supplied TVC systems for the Ariane 4, Ariane 5, and now Ariane 6 rockets, as well as for Avio’s Vega and Vega C rockets.
The SATCOMBw-2 constellation was launched aboard Ariane 5 rockets in 2009 and 2010.
The 28-meter-tall rocket stage was assembled in 2023 at the former main stage integration building for Ariane 5 in Les Mureaux, France.
Delays in Ariane 6 development, retirement of Ariane 5, the loss of Soyuz access after Russia’s invasion of Ukraine, and the grounding of Vega C in late 2022 created a gap in European access to space.
Europe experienced a launcher gap caused by delays in Ariane 6, retirement of Ariane 5, loss of access to Soyuz after Russia’s invasion of Ukraine, and the grounding of Vega C after a failure in late 2022.
The James Webb Space Telescope is also positioned at the Lagrange point 2, having been delivered there by the European predecessor launch vehicle Ariane 5 in December 2021.
The Vega C return to flight followed the retirement of Ariane 5 and delays in the introduction of Ariane 6, contributing to a European launcher shortfall that required use of SpaceX Falcon 9 launches for key science and navigation spacecraft.
